Well I spiced it up a notch on this cavendish run. With Perique, I have no clue what I am doing but it smells good.
Brown Sugar, vanella extract and almond extract.
I got it all combined and simmering then added the leaf into the mixture the leaf was very dry so it would absorb the casing. Let soak in the brine for three beers, I drink fast. Approx 15 min.
Put it on the steam rack and we will see in the morning.

Nice jeans. The color looks right. Wrap the plug in plastic wrap. Maybe place 4 large hook eyes near the upper perimeter.

My take on the length of airing is that it just needs to be well exposed to air (a minute or two), then it can go back in. Make sure the margins are sealed with water.
